Abstract

Générateur électrochimique à électrode positive comportant un chaloegénure. Il comprend une électrode positive, un électrolyte, une électrode négative, caractérisé par le fait que ladite électrode positive comporte au moins un chalcogénure du type (MYk Xz ), M étant un elément choisi parmi les éléments des colonnes IIa, IIb, IVb, Vb, VIIb de la classification périodique des éléments ainsi que parmi le fer, le cobalt, le nickel, l'étain, le plomb, Y étant un élément choisi parmi les éléments de la colonne Va de ladite classification périodique, X étant un élément choisi parmi le soufre, le sélénium, le tellure, k pouvant être égal à 0 ou 1, z étant au moins égal à 3. L'invention est mise en oeuvre dans les générateurs électrochimiques secondaires.
